Why KKR (KKR) Is Back In The Spotlight
KKR (KKR) is in focus due to a new alliance with NVIDIA and global asset managers to support AI infrastructure. KKR's share price is $108.48, with mixed returns: +13.56% 30-day, -15.84% YTD, and -22.93% 1-year. Analysts have varying views on its valuation, with some seeing it as 28.5% overvalued at a fair value of $84.45, while a DCF model suggests a discount of 25.4%.
